Background
Trees can adjust the weather, keep ecological balance, trees pass through photosynthesis and absorb carbon dioxide, breathing out oxygen, make the air fresh, and trees play the effect of afforestation environment, in recent years, because people improve the degree of attention of afforestation environment, the cool continuous expansion of tree cultivation planting, people also improve relatively to the survival rate requirement of trees, trees are when just cultivating, because the root system has not yet stretched, the easy emergence is emptyd the phenomenon, cause the survival rate reduction of trees, in order to make better survival of trees, support trees through strutting arrangement.
However, the existing tree supporting device generally utilizes a wood pole or a bamboo pole to fix trees, the diameter of the wood pole changes in the process of tree growth, so that repeated correction and modification are needed, and the same supporting device cannot directly support trees with different sizes and widths, so that the use is limited.

Embodiment 1, as shown in fig. 1-4, the utility model provides a tree supporting device for landscaping construction, which comprises a clamp component 1, wherein the clamp component 1 comprises a connecting piece 11, two ends of the connecting piece 11 are respectively hinged with a first hoop 12 and a second hoop 13, the outer surfaces of the first hoop 12 and the second hoop 13 are both hinged with a bracket 2, one end of the bracket 2, which is far away from the first hoop 12 and the second hoop 13, is hinged with a stabilizing component 3, and a stabilizing disc 4 is fixedly installed at the bottom of the stabilizing component 3.
The specific arrangement and operation of the clip assembly 1 and the stabilizing assembly 3 will be described in detail below.
As shown in fig. 1 and 2, one end of the first hoop 12, which is far away from the connecting piece 11, is provided with a groove 14, the inside of the second hoop 13 is provided with a sliding groove 16, the inner wall of the sliding groove 16 is connected with a sliding block 17 in a sliding manner, a first spring 19 is fixedly connected between the sliding block 17 and the sliding groove 16, one end, which is far away from the first spring 19, of the sliding block 17 is hinged with a hinge rod 18, the hinge rod 18 penetrates through the sliding groove 16 and extends to the outside of the sliding groove 16, the hinge rod 18 is located at one end, which is outside the sliding groove 16, of the hinge rod and is matched with the size of the groove 14, holes are formed in the inside of the groove 14 and the hinge rod 18, and a bolt 15 is inserted in the inside of the holes.
The whole hoop component 1 achieves the effect that by arranging the hoop component 1, when the hoop component 1 needs to be installed, only the bolt 15 needs to be pulled out, the bolt 15 is enabled to be separated from the groove 14 and the hinge rod 18 at the same time, the first hoop 12 and the second hoop 13 rotate, the distance between the first hoop 12 and the second hoop 13 is enabled to be increased, the first hoop 12 is enabled to pull the hinge rod 18, the groove 14 and the hinge rod 18 are combined again, the bolt 341 is inserted, when the trunk of a tree grows and changes, the trunk thickens and extrudes the first hoop 12, the first hoop 12 pulls the hinge rod 18, the hinge rod 18 pulls the sliding block 17 to slide along the inner wall of the sliding groove 16, the first spring 19 is pulled, the resilience force of the first spring 19 can firmly enable the first hoop 12 and the second hoop 13 to be tightly attached to the outer surface of the trunk, by arranging the hoop component 1, make during installation and dismantlement, easy and simple to handle is convenient, can satisfy the condition that trees trunk becomes thick when growing simultaneously, has avoided trunk to become thick to need more renewed fixing device, also can satisfy the trunk of different thicknesses simultaneously, has improved the device's flexibility and has used and the practicality.
As shown in fig. 3 and 4, the stabilizing assembly 3 includes a connecting column 31, the connecting column 31 is hinged to one end of the bracket 2, a limiting groove 32 is formed on the outer surface of the connecting column 31, a limiting block 35 is slidably connected to the inner wall of the limiting groove 32, a traction rod 36 is hinged to the outer surface of the limiting block 35, a moving groove 41 is formed on the outer surface of the stabilizing disc 4, a hollow block 38 is slidably connected to the inner wall of the moving groove 41, a strip-shaped groove 383 is formed inside the hollow block 38, a sliding block 39 is slidably connected to the inner wall of the strip-shaped groove 383, an extending plate 310 is hinged to the outer surface of the sliding block 39, a screw 311 is rotatably connected to one end of the extending plate 310 away from the sliding block 39, an anchor rod 312 is sleeved on the outer surface of the screw 311, limiting holes 33 are formed inside the limiting block 35, the sliding ring 34 and the limiting groove 32, a bolt 341 is inserted into the inner wall of the limiting hole 33, and a second spring 37 is fixedly installed between the limiting block 35 and the surface opposite to the limiting groove 32, the outer surface of hollow block 38 articulates there is the bull stick 381, and the one end that the bull stick 381 kept away from hollow block 38 articulates there is the locating lever 382, and locating hole 3101 has been seted up at the top of extension board 310, and the size looks adaptation of locating hole 3101 and locating lever 382.
The whole stabilizing component 3 has the effects that by arranging the stabilizing component 3, when a trunk needs to be fixed, the bolt 341 is pulled out, the sliding ring 34 is slid, the sliding ring 34 extrudes the limiting block 35, the limiting block 35 slides along the inner wall of the limiting groove 32 and drives the traction rod 36 to pull the hollow block 38, the hollow block 38 slides along the inner wall of the moving groove 41, the sliding block 39 slides along the sliding block 39, the sliding block 39 slides along the inside of the strip-shaped groove 383 and rotates the extension plate, the extension plate drives the anchor rod 312 to be right opposite to the ground, the screw rod 311 is rotated at the moment, the anchor rod 312 is perpendicular to the ground, the anchor rod 312 is inserted into the inside of the ground to be fixed, the rotating rod 381 is rotated at the moment, the positioning rod 382 is driven to be inserted into the positioning hole 3101 to limit the extension plate to achieve secondary fixing, and the clamp component 1 is effectively stabilized through twice fixing, and support the trunk from all around, avoided the trunk that has just transplanted to receive the influence of external force or wind-force, the effectual trunk that has stabilized has improved the stability of trunk.
